Admission Details
Qualifying examination for Admission - PET & JEE (Mains)
Admission to all the courses is conducted through Central Online Counseling administered by Directorate of Technical Education, Government of Chhattisgarh. The dates and other details of such counselling are displayed through advertisement in local newspapers as well as their official website (www.cgdteraipur.ac.in). However, admission under Sponsored Category, Part Time courses and management Quota seats are administered at the Institute level.
-
Eligibility Criteria
Candidates must pass Intermediate Examination or equivalent (10+2 Level) from any recognized Board/University with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ics.
For Lateral Entry (LEET) Second Year
Passing three-year diploma in engineering from any recognized Board/University/Institute with minimum 45% marks (aggregate) or with minimum 45% marks in the final year for UR category and 40% for SC, ST, OBC category and PWD candidates of Chhattisgarh is essential.
OR
Passing B.Sc exam from recognized Universiy/Institute with minimum 45% marks (aggregate) or with minimum 45% marks in the final year for UR category and with 40% for SC, ST and OBC category and with 40% for SC, ST, and OBC category and PWD candidate of Chattisgarh is essential. In addition, passing 12th with mathematics as the subject is essential. B.Sc candidate shall be considered only when diploma candidates are not available.
